Welcome to inklink, a powerful blogging platform that connects writers with their audience through seamless content sharing. Craft captivating content with generative AI, prompt engineering, and an intuitive UI, and share it effortlessly on different blogging platforms.
To get started with inklink, follow the installation and usage instructions in the project's documentation.
git clone https://github.com/ayushsoni1010/inklink.git
cd inklink
npm install
Configure the environment variables, including API keys and settings.
First, run the development server:
npm run dev
# or
yarn dev
# or
pnpm dev
This is a Next.js project bootstrapped with create-next-app
.
Open http://localhost:3000 with your browser to see the result.
You can start editing the page by modifying app/page.tsx
. The page auto-updates as you edit the file.
This project uses next/font
to automatically optimize and load Inter, a custom Google Font.
